Copper powders also have some minor specialized applications. Following are some of such applications:
- Cold casting (sculpture, prototypes)
- Copper clay (custom jewelry, sculptures)
- Antifouling (Antifouling paints and coatings)
- Fungicide (paint, drywall)
- Algaecide (in pond equipment components)
- Patina
- EMF shielding
- Data security shielding
